About the Role & Team
We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Senior Finance Analyst to join our finance team. This role will support multiple lines of business (Media Networks, Theatrical, Streaming) and collaborate closely with cross-functional teams. The ideal candidate will have strong analytical capabilities, a proactive mindset, and a passion for simplifying complex data into actionable insights. This position plays a key role in financial reporting, planning, and forecasting, and will be instrumental in supporting new business growth initiatives.
This role will require you to be working 4 days a week in our office and 1 day from home.
What You Will Do
Create, maintain, and improve recurring and ad-hoc financial reports to streamline work across the finance and business teams.
Deliver monthly and quarterly results reporting with detailed analysis, data validation, and commentary for multiple business areas.
Support month-end and quarter-end processes, including preparation of accruals, reconciliations, and transaction reclassifications.
Collaborate with business stakeholders to provide financial insights and ad-hoc analysis.
Assist in budgeting and forecasting cycles by preparing templates, consolidating submissions, and checking completeness and accuracy of data received.
Contribute to new business growth initiatives by providing financial modelling, scenario analysis, and profitability insights.
Required Qualifications & Skills
3–5 years of experience in a financial analysis or business finance role, ideally in a cross-functional environment.
Bachelor’s or master’s degree in fin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field.
Fluent in the wider Microsoft 365 stack (Excel, Teams, Outlook, OneDrive, Planner, Forms, Loop, Microsoft Lists) and ability to weave those apps into end-to-end automated solutions.
Hands-on experience designing information architecture in SharePoint Online (lists, libraries, site columns, content types, managed metadata).
Knowledge on how to design repeatable extract-transform-load (ETL) pipelines with Power Query (M language) in Excel, Power BI Dataflows or Dataverse.
Demonstrated ability to turn messy, multi-source data into a clean, dependable dataset that downstream reports and workflows can trust.
Experience with SAP S/4HANA systems, including navigating modules, extracting data, and understanding core business processes within the platform.
Strong verbal and written communication skills in English; ability to clearly explain financial topics to non-financial stakeholders.
Proven organizational skills and attention to detail, with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ines.
Self-starter with the ability to work independently as well as collaboratively in a team setting with multiple stakeholders.
